Creating Folders in Gmail

The first step to organizing your emails is creating a folder system. Here’s how to make new folders on desktop and mobile:

On Desktop

  1. Click the gear icon ⚙️ > Settings
  2. Select Labels from the menu
  3. Click Create New Label
  4. Enter folder name > Create

You can make subfolders by checking “Nest label under” and selecting a parent folder.

On Mobile

  1. Open Gmail app
  2. Tap ≡ Menu icon
  3. Tap Labels
  4. Tap Create new
  5. Enter label name > Save

Organizing Your Folders

Once you’ve created folders, it’s time to organize them into an effective system. Here are some tips:

Folder Structure

Group similar topics and use subfolders for specificity:

  • Personal
    • Family
    • Friends
    • Shopping
  • Work
    • Clients
      • Client 1
      • Client 2
    • Projects
      • Project 1
      • Project 2

Moving Emails

To file emails properly:

  • Open message
  • Click Move To
  • Select destination folder

Bulk move multiple emails at once by checking boxes and selecting Move.

Managing Folders

Maintaining your folder structure over time ensures it stays optimized. Here’s how:

Editing

To rename or re-color folders:

Desktop: Settings > Labels > Click folder > Edit

Mobile: Menu > Labels > Tap folder > Edit

Deleting

To remove unnecessary folders:

Desktop: Settings > Labels > Click trash can icon

Mobile: Menu > Labels > Tap folder > Delete
